Position Summary

This role focuses on the coordination and design of installations, extensions and/or system improvements. Specific work varies by area.


Tasks And Responsibilities

Residential Developments - Designs the installation of overhead line extensions, underground electric line extensions and gas main extensions for new residential subdivisions and apartment complexes.
Landbase Services – coordinates the verification of edits, QA/QC, and closing of as-built designs with Designers, Construction personnel, Site Inspectors, and Schedulers
Commercial Services - Coordinates and designs line extensions and service installations/upgrades/remodels for commercial customers.
Large Commercial Services - Coordinates and designs line extensions and service installations/upgrades/remodels for large commercial and industrial customers and developments.
Overhead Engineering - Coordinates and designs overhead electric system improvement projects and civic improvement projects.
Underground Engineering - Coordinates and designs underground electric system improvement projects and civic improvement projects.
Downtown Network Engineering - Coordinates and designs all customer service installations, system improvement projects and civic improvement projects in the Downtown Network System.
Gas Engineering - Coordinates and designs gas system improvement/renewal projects; civic improvement projects; and large line extensions and service installations/upgrades/remodels for large commercial and industrial customers and developments.
Perform all coordination with external agencies such as the City of San Antonio, TxDOT, etc.,
Conduct field surveying for the design and installation for each job, including staking pole locations and locating buried utilities
Develop job sketches and perform As-builts
Performs other project and process improvement initiatives as assigned.
